How much do cision j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for cision in the United States is $47,442.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45,000.00 and $48,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ical responsibilities of a Cision Account Manager on a daily basis?

As a Cision Account Manager, your daily responsibilities often include managing client relationships, providing training and support on Cision's media monitoring and PR software, and ensuring clients achieve their campaign goals. You will regularly analyze media coverage data, prepare performance reports, and collaborate with both internal teams and client stakeholders to optimize service delivery.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are essential, as you'll frequently address client queries and proactively identify opportunities to enhance their experience with the platform.

What are Cision jobs?

Cision jobs refer to roles at Cision, a global provider of public relations software and media intelligence services. Employees at Cision work in various departments such as sales, marketing, customer support, software development, and data analysis. These roles typically focus on helping clients manage media relations, monitor press coverage, and analyze public sentiment. Working at Cision often involves collaborating with communications professionals and utilizing technology to support PR and marketing campaigns. The company values innovation, teamwork, and a strong understanding of the media landscape.

Summary
This role is responsible for owning, retaining, and growing large, complex Enterprise and Government accounts by driving significant expansion of ARR and durable NRR performance. This role leads strategic account planning, multi-year expansion strategies, account management, and complex renewal negotiations across executive-level, procurement, and compliance-driven buying environments.

What you'll do
* Own and deliver expansion ARR quota and renewal outcomes within Enterprise and Government accounts.
* Develop and execute strategic, multi-year account plans focused on long-term value expansion.
* Lead advanced discovery across executive, users, procurement, security, and technical stakeholders.
* Navgate regulatory, compliance, and procurement frameworks associated with Enterprise and Government customers.
* Drive complex expansion negotiations with higher average selling prices and extended sales cycles.
* Lead and execute the Meddpicc sales process throughout an assignment book on Enterprise clients.
* Proactively manage renewal risk and pricing strategy to protect NRR performance.
* Maintain strong forecast accuracy and commercial inspection rigor.
* Partner cross-functionally to align expansion strategy with delivery capacity and portfolio roadmap.
* Lead a team approach of resources and elevate account planning standards. .
* Perform other duties and responsibilities as required to support business needs.
